Bilby Ranch Dam

TR NODAWAY RIVER· Nodaway, Missouri· Built 1991· Earth· 54 ft tall
Low Hazard Fish And Wildlife Pond State Government

Key Takeaway

Bilby Ranch Dam is classified as low hazard in Missouri. It was completed in 1991 and is 35 years old. Its primary use is fish and wildlife pond.

Physical Details

Dam Height 54 ft (taller than 96.1% in MO)
Dam Length1,482 ft
Dam TypeEarth
Max Storage3.0K acre-ft
Normal Storage1.4K acre-ft
Surface Area110 acres
Drainage Area3 sq mi
Max Discharge0 cfs
Year Completed1991 (35 years old)
NID IDMO12280

Safety Information

Low Hazard

No probable loss of human life and low economic/environmental losses expected.

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?

Emergency Action Plan: No
Last Inspection: July 13, 2022
State Regulated: Yes
Regulatory Agency: Dam and Reservoir Safety Program

Ownership

MO DEPT OF CONSERVATION

State Government
